What Corporation Taxes Are
Corporation taxes are what a company pays on its profits. Every registered company must follow these rules. The government sets these rules. You must file returns and pay what you owe on time.
If you don’t keep up, you might face penalties or interest fees. This can hurt your business’s money. Staying on top of taxes helps you keep more of your profits.

Accounting for Simpler Tax Filing
Bookkeeping is a vital role. It lets you know exactly what your income and expenses are.
Some businesses use software to help with this. Programs like QuickBooks Accounting and Peachtree Accounting help organise your transactions. They can track sales, purchases, and payments easily. This organised data saves time and lowers the chance of errors when you file your corporate taxes. If your books are messy, tax filing can be a headache.
